Score 90/100 · Stephen Tanzer, Vinous, Mar 2005

Medium red. Raspberry, smoke, coffee and earth on the nose. Velvety and sweet, with harmonious acidity giving shape to the wine's flavors. Finishes lush, sweet and long, with a fine dusting of tannins.

Score 86-88/100 · Drink 2006-2011, Pierre Rovani, Jun 2004

A firm, rustic wine, the 2002 Beaune Greves Vigne de l’Enfant Jesus (domaine) lacks the hedonistic jammy fruit and supple personalities of Bouchard’s other 2002 Beaunes. Light to medium-bodied, it displays brambleberries and blackberries in a bright, foursquare character. This wine will need to soften and blossom to ultimately merit a score in the upper eighties. Score 92/100 · Allen Meadows, Burghound, Apr 2004

The recent mise has not troubled this either as the nose is wonderfully expressive, rich and classy, leading to concentrated, dense, pure, textured and beautifully detailed and precise flavors that ooze minerality and sap on the wonderfully long finish. This is very powerful for a Beaune 1er and it will be capable of aging for two decades, perhaps longer.

Score 89-92/100 · Stephen Tanzer, Vinous, Mar 2004

Red-ruby. Black raspberry, chocolate, leather and game on the reduced nose. Broad and lush in the middle, with sappy, nuanced fruit flavors of considerable depth. The toothdusting tannins arrive quite late, allowing the fruit, smoke and game flavors to linger. All of these Beaune wines should benefit from three or four years of aging.

Bouchard Père & Fils

Bouchard Père & Fils is one of Burgundy’s oldest and most established wine producers. Founded in 1731 by Michel Bouchard, it is the largest vineyard owner in the Côte d’Or with 130 hectares of vines.
